Description

Fetus at approximately 20 weeks’ gestation occupies the uterine cavity in a lateral profile, with the fetal head oriented superiorly and the trunk flexed along the long axis of the uterus. Placental tissue is attached to the uterine wall, and the umbilical cord courses from the fetal umbilicus to its placental insertion, suspended within the amniotic space. The amnion and chorion are implied as the membranes separating fetus and placenta from the surrounding myometrium, while the cervix and lower uterine segment form the inferior boundary of the gravid uterus. Black fetal skin tone is represented consistently across exposed surfaces. Week 20 sits in the middle of the second trimester, when clinicians correlate fetal position, placental location, and cord insertion with sonographic anatomy and obstetric risk, including placenta previa, marginal cord insertion, and oligohydramnios or polyhydramnios suggested by relative amniotic volume. A lateral perspective supports teaching of fetal lie and longitudinal relationships, such as the fundus superiorly and the cervix inferiorly, without confusing left right reversal that can occur in transabdominal ultrasound screenshots.
